The Use of Visual Aids to Navigation

Paperback
by Squire, David
The advance of technology has changed the development of, and reliance on, visual aids to navigation but they continue to be vital tools for mariners to assess and verify their position. They provide situational awareness and orientation, indicate current flow and afford redundancy for electronic systems. They also highlight individual dangers such as wrecks, rocks and shoals. Admiralty Manual of Navigation Vol 2: Astro Navigation

Hardback
by Royal Navy
11th edition. Satellite technology enables almost every mariner to use electronic navaids to fix their position on the oceans. However, electronic systems can be disrupted by errors in a satellite or its ground control systems, defects in shipboard equipment or interference with satellite signals. Handling Ships in First-Year Ice

Paperback
by Johan Buysse
First-year ice remains a major obstacle for commercial traffic, limiting vessel's speed and manoeuvrability. Ice has the potential to damage propellers, main engines, rudders and hull plating, and creates a greater risk of collision with structures and other vessels.
